This barn was built, by the owner himself, in 1962. Interestingly, he cut the roof joists with that curve that the roof follows. How? I still do not understand. While I was shooting, that cow just stood there, intermittently mooing at me, which is strange behavior in my experience. I asked the owner about it and he explained that his name was Buddy. When he was born his mother’s teat was too big for him to suckle, so he had to hand feed him for the first few months. In Buddy’s eyes he almost became a family pet at that point. He did admit that Buddy would be going to the butcher that fall, however. I expressed my surprise that that would be Buddy’s fate. He hooked his thumb over his shoulder at a hillside of grazing cows and exclaimed, “He’ll taste the same as them!”
